American illustrator and writer Lou Cameron attended the California School of Fine Arts. He was active as a comic book artist in the 1950s and was a versatile artist for Gilberton's 'Classics Illustrated' series, drawing comic adaptations of novels by Herbert George Wells, Ann S. Stephens, Alexandre Dumas, Emile Zola, and Robert Louis Stevenson. He was also a contributor to the mystery titles published by Atlas, including Astonishing Comics, Journey into Mystery, Uncanny Tales, and Journey Into Unknown Worlds. He illustrated stories in the same genre for DC titles like House of Mystery, House of Secrets, and Tales of the Unexpected, as well as Ace Periodicals' Baffling Mysteries, Web of Mystery, and Hand of Fate. Additionally, he created horror stories for St. John Publishing and romance and western features for Story Comics. In 1951 and 1952, he produced a syndicated feature called 'So It Seems.' During the same period, Cameron was active as a pulp book illustrator. From 1957, he focused on his work as a writer, which he did under his own name as well as the pseudonyms Julie Cameron, Dagmar, Mary Manning, and Ramsay Thorne. Among his many novels, mainly in suspense, war, and western genres, are 'Beyond the Scarlet Door,' 'The Amphorae Pirates,' 'Belle of Fort Smith,' and 'The Dirty War of Sgt. Slade,' as well as the 'Stringer' western series.
